Summary of Criminal Appeal No. 235/2002 On 11 February 2002, the Supreme Court heard Mohammed Anwar's appeal against the High Court of Rajasthan's refusal to grant leave to appeal in a case involving charges under Sections 452, 147, 148, 323, 324, 325, 326, and 504 IPC read with 149. The Court found that the High Court erred in dismissing the appeal based merely on alleged contradictions in witness depositions without properly appreciating the evidence of injured witnesses. The Court allowed the appeal, set aside the High Court's refusal order, and remitted the matter back to the High Court for decision on merits.
